British Airways Boeing Dreamliner Makes Emergency Landing in Azerbaijan
A British Airways Boeing 787-9 Dreamliner, flight BA268 from London Heathrow to Kuala Lumpur, made an emergency landing in Baku, Azerbaijan, on June 16, 2024, due to a reported medical emergency involving a passenger. The flight, carrying hundreds of passengers, was diverted as a precautionary measure to ensure the individual received immediate medical attention.
The unscheduled landing occurred at Heydar Aliyev International Airport in Baku. Emergency services were on standby to meet the aircraft upon arrival. The passenger requiring medical assistance was swiftly attended to by medical professionals. While the exact nature of the medical emergency remains undisclosed, sources indicate it was serious enough to warrant an immediate diversion.
British Airways confirmed the incident, stating that the safety and well-being of its passengers and crew are their top priority. The airline is working diligently to minimize disruption and ensure passengers reach their final destination as quickly as possible. Passengers were provided with accommodation and meals while awaiting a replacement aircraft.

The airline dispatched a replacement aircraft to Baku to continue the flight to Kuala Lumpur. Passengers were expected to resume their journey after a significant delay. British Airways expressed its regret for the inconvenience caused by the unexpected diversion and praised the crew for their professional handling of the situation. The airline also expressed gratitude to the airport authorities in Baku for their prompt assistance. Further details regarding the passenger’s condition have not been released, respecting their privacy.
